The AP Credit Chart for 2022-2023 outlines the Advanced Placement exam credits awarded by Riverside Community College District (RCCD). It details how AP exam scores translate into college credit, including specific courses and units applicable toward associate degrees and general education requirements. Students can find information on various subjects, including Biology, Calculus, Chemistry, and more, along with the corresponding RCCD unit credits and transfer options for CSU and UC systems.
